Skip to content

ci: centralize ci-package-manager#92

Merged
aladdin-add merged 5 commits intomainfrom
lumirlumir-patch-5
Dec 10, 2025
Merged

ci: centralize ci-package-manager#92
aladdin-add merged 5 commits intomainfrom
lumirlumir-patch-5

Conversation

@lumirlumir
Copy link
Member

@lumirlumir lumirlumir commented Oct 22, 2025

Prerequisites checklist

What is the purpose of this pull request?

In this PR, I've centralized the ci-package-manager workflow as part of the effort to centralize workflows (ref: eslint/workflows#4).

For detailed context, please refer to eslint/workflows#25.

What changes did you make? (Give an overview)

In this PR, I centralized the ci-package-manager workflow.

Related Issues

Refs: eslint/workflows#25, eslint/workflows#4

Is there anything you'd like reviewers to focus on?

N/A

@coveralls
Copy link

coveralls commented Oct 22, 2025

Pull Request Test Coverage Report for Build 20088060751

Details

  • 0 of 0 changed or added relevant lines in 0 files are covered.
  • No unchanged relevant lines lost coverage.
  • Overall coverage remained the same at 98.551%

Totals Coverage Status
Change from base Build 19815639005: 0.0%
Covered Lines: 11927
Relevant Lines: 12068

💛 - Coveralls

@nzakas nzakas moved this from Needs Triage to Implementing in Triage Oct 22, 2025
@github-actions
Copy link

github-actions bot commented Nov 1, 2025

Hi everyone, it looks like we lost track of this pull request. Please review and see what the next steps are. This pull request will auto-close in 7 days without an update.

@github-actions github-actions bot added the Stale label Nov 1, 2025
@lumirlumir lumirlumir added accepted and removed Stale labels Nov 2, 2025
@lumirlumir lumirlumir changed the title ci: create ci-bun.yml ci: centralize ci-package-manager Dec 7, 2025
@lumirlumir lumirlumir marked this pull request as ready for review December 10, 2025 05:11
@lumirlumir lumirlumir moved this from Implementing to Needs Triage in Triage Dec 10, 2025
Copy link

Copilot AI left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Pull request overview

This PR centralizes the ci-package-manager workflow by delegating to a reusable workflow in the eslint/workflows repository, following the pattern established by other centralized workflows in this project (e.g., stale.yml, add-to-triage.yml, update-readme.yml).

  • Added new centralized workflow file that triggers on push and pull requests to the main branch
  • Updated .gitignore to exclude *.tgz files generated by npm pack operations

Reviewed changes

Copilot reviewed 1 out of 2 changed files in this pull request and generated no comments.

File Description
.gitignore Added exclusion for *.tgz files produced by npm pack command
.github/workflows/ci-package-manager.yml New workflow file that delegates to centralized reusable workflow for package manager CI testing

💡 Add Copilot custom instructions for smarter, more guided reviews. Learn how to get started.

@aladdin-add aladdin-add merged commit 898fcf3 into main Dec 10, 2025
47 checks passed
@github-project-automation github-project-automation bot moved this from Needs Triage to Complete in Triage Dec 10, 2025
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Projects

Status: Complete

Development

Successfully merging this pull request may close these issues.

6 participants